Secretary of StateIntervention at Sixth ASEAN Regional Forum Intervention
at Sixth ASEAN Regional Forum
Singapore, July 26, 1999
As released by the Office of the Spokesman
U.S. Department of State

Extract on Burma
-------------------------
Burma: Burma continues to pose a threat to regional stability because of
the governments failure to prevent wide-scale narcotics production and
trafficking activities, and because its repressive policies have created
strife and caused the outflow of refugees.



The United States urges Burma to shift direction and begin a dialogue with
the democratic opposition, including Aung San Suu Kyi, and other
representative groups. We support the UN role in encouraging this, and are
disappointed that Special Envoy DeSoto has not yet been able to return to
Burma, despite several requests over the past six months. We call upon the
Burmese authorities to allow such a visit as soon as possible.
